The Fundamentals of Changing Your IRA Into Gold

Transferring assets from a regular individual Retirement Account (IRA) or 401(k) into an self-directed Individual Retirement Account (IRA) that allows the investment in precious metals like gold is required in order to change an IRA to gold. Through this method, people can diversify their retirement portfolios and include gold in their assets for their stability and the potential for growth.

Physical gold as well as gold exchange-traded funds (ETFs), and gold mining equity companies are just a few examples of gold-related investments that can be used to save for retirement. Gold may be acquired in the form of coins or bars, and stored in a safe container by the person buying. Gold exchange-traded funds (also called gold ETFs are investments that follow the price of gold and may be bought and traded on stock markets. Shares of companies which mine for gold and provide exposure to the gold market are referred to as mining stocks in gold.

How to Pick a Good Custodian for Your Gold IRA

It is vital to ensure your assets are protected and safe by choosing the right custodian for your gold IRA with a good reputation and can be trusted. Custodians’ responsibilities consist of the storage and security of your gold assets as well as the ease of doing business and the distribution of accounts statements.

When choosing a custodian, it is important to look at the history of the company and reputation. It is best to look for custodians that have been in business for a considerable amount of time and have a good reputation in the field that they operate in. It is also essential that you ensure the custodian’s insurance is in place and that they follow the appropriate security measures to protect your valuables.

In addition, it’s ideal to think about the expenses associated to the custodian’s services. If you sell or purchase gold, some custodians will charge transaction fees, and others may levy yearly expenses dependent on the value of your account. It is vital to have a solid understanding of these costs and you consider them in your overall investment plan.

The Pros and Cons of Investing in Gold Through an IRA

Investing in a gold IRA comes with positives and negatives, as with every other investment. The potential for profit from having gold inside an IRA is one of the main advantages of investing in one. As we mentioned earlier gold has always shown an increasing trend to appreciate over the long run. This can help people to increase their funds for retirement by providing an increase in their retirement savings.

The stability of gold is another advantage when investing in gold using a traditional or Roth IRA. Gold has a long history of sustaining its value, and in times of uncertainty about the economy or market volatility it is possible that its value will rise. Because of this stability the retirement funds of people may be better able to weather market fluctuations.

However, investments in an investment in gold IRA are not without the possibility of experiencing adverse consequences. The volatility of the gold market itself is one of the main risks that investors are exposed to. Gold is a commodity that is often thought of as being stable. Yet, its price may change in response to a variety of factors, such as the economic situation and political climate in different regions, and the attitude of investors.

A gold investment through your IRA is not a source of income, which is a possible disadvantage. In contrast to stocks and bonds, gold does not provide dividends or interest payments. It’s likely that those who’s sole source of income in retirement is gold will have to sell some of their gold holdings in order to produce cash flow.

Tax Implications of Converting an Individual Retirement Account to Gold

Making the switch from your retirement account (IRA) into gold could have tax consequences that people must be aware of. When people convert a standard personal retirement account (IRA) or 401(k) into a gold personal retirement account (IRA) they run the possibility of being taxed on the funds converted. This is because conventional IRAs and 401(k) plans are typically funded with cash before tax, which indicates that the persons contributing money still need to pay taxes on these assets.

When converting from a traditional IRA to a gold IRA the holder must make tax payments on the conversion at the same rate as their regular income. Contacting a tax expert or financial adviser is crucial to understanding the tax consequences of the conversion of your IRA to gold and how it may impact your tax situation in general. This is because potential modifications could be made to your IRA that could influence your overall tax situation.

How to Stay Out of Jail When Converting Your Retirement Account to Gold

To avoid penalties, you must change your IRA into gold, while adhering to all of the rules and regulations set by the IRS. Choosing a custodian specializing in self-directed individual retirement accounts (IRAs) is one of the most important requirements that you must be aware of. This is because private individuals aren’t allowed to buy gold on their own and keep it at their residences; instead they must utilize a custodian authorized by the IRS.

Additionally, they must ensure that the gold they buy to fund their retirement account meets certain standards of purity. To be eligible for an Individual Retirement Account (IRA), gold must be of an purity level of at minimum 99.5%. This verifies that the gold meets the requirements outlined by the IRS and enables it to be eligible for advantageous tax benefits.

Including Gold in Your Investment Portfolio as You Approach Retirement

When planning for retirement, diversification is essential because it spreads risk and protects your money from the volatility of market conditions. Including gold in your investing portfolio in retirement can help you diversify your holdings and offer security during times of economic unpredictability.

The past performance of gold has been characterized by a poor relationship with other asset classes, such as bonds and equity. This indicates that even when other assets’ value, like bonds or stocks, go down, gold’s value could stay the same or even rise. You can lower the overall volatility of your investments and protect your money from market downturns by including gold as part of your retirement portfolio.
